We bought two 3 day passes for our recent trip to London. We didn't do our research (dumb) and relied solely on their website reviews (which were all positive). The passes cost us £196 and in the 3 days we saved £14! The passes did not include a bus tour...
Started by Jannellg on
, 11 posts
by 8 people.
Answer Snippets (Read the full thread at tripadvisor):
There are so many free museums and art galleries in London, and I fear that many purchasers of the London Pass really want to visit a lot of the places it covers, but if purchased it should only be for part of a longer stay....
